Summary

LU5 4RT is a large user postcode in Dunstable, Central Bedfordshire. It was first introduced in January 1980.

'Large User' postcodes are allocated to organisations which receive large amounts of post. Unlike standard geographic postcodes, which cover up to 80 addresses, a large user postcode is unique to a single address.

To the best of our knowledge, the current address of this postcode is:
The Old Palace Lodge, Church Street, Dunstable LU5 4RT.

The geographic coordinates assigned to a large user postcode may not necessarily be the actual coordinates of the location to which mail is delivered. If the address is a PO Box, then the coordinates will usually be the Royal Mail sorting office which handles mail for that postcode. In other cases, the coordinates of the postcode may be the headquarters, or registered office, of an organisation rather than the building which receives mail.
